Ammonia is often an excellent indication of the presence of animal or plant microbiological decay. It is tested in fish farms both in fresh as well as salt water tanks due to the damaging effects of its toxic nature. Its presence in rivers and reservoirs normally points to agriculture and/or civil pollutants. Ammonia is tested among others in lakes, rivers, potable water, boiler feed water, sewage, industrial and waste water.
Specifications
Range:
0.00 to 3.00 mg/L
Resolution:
0.01 mg/L
Accuracy (@20°C/68°F)
±0.04 mg/L ±4% of reading
Typical EMC Deviation:
±0.01 mg/L
Light Source
Light Emitting Diode @ 470 nm
Light Life
Life of the instrument
Light Detector
Silicon Photocell
Battery Type/Life
1 x 9V / Approximately 40 hours of continuous use. Auto-shut off after 10 minutes of non-use
Dimensions / Weight
180 x 83 x 46mm (7.1 x 3.3 x 1.8") / 290g (10 oz.)
Method
Adaptation of the ASTM Manual of Water and Environmental Technology, D1426-92, Nessler method. The reaction between ammonia and reagents causes a yellow tint in the sample.
